CVS Health operates a large network of retail pharmacies and walk-in medical clinics across the United States, providing a variety of health-related products and services. Their offerings include prescription medications, over-the-counter health products, beauty items, and general merchandise. CVS Health also functions as a pharmacy benefits manager, serving over 75 million plan members, and has a senior pharmacy care business that assists more than one million patients each year. This integrated model allows CVS Health to deliver affordable health management solutions, improving access to quality care and health outcomes while aiming to reduce overall healthcare costs. Unlike many competitors, CVS Health combines retail pharmacy services with clinical care, making it a significant player in the healthcare sector with a commitment to enhancing the health of individuals and communities.

What makes CVS Health unique

  • CVS Health operates over 9,600 retail pharmacies and 1,100 walk-in clinics nationwide.
  • The company integrates pharmacy benefits management with specialty pharmacy services for comprehensive care.
  • CVS Health offers a wide range of health products, enhancing accessibility and affordability.
